半套式PCR扩增人抗HFRS病毒抗体基因及Fd段基因的克隆和序列分析

Amplification of genes of human antibodies against HFRS virus using semi nested polymerase chain reaction and cloning, sequencing of Fd fragments

摘要 从肾综合征出血热恢复期患者外周血淋巴细胞(PBL) 中提取细胞总RNA, 反转录成cDNA 。以之为模板,用半套式聚合酶链反应(PCR) 扩增人Ig G 抗体Fd 段及轻链基因,并将Fd 段基因克隆入噬菌体载体pco m b3 ;经酶切鉴定后,再亚克隆入pGEM7zf ,筛选阳性克隆测序。经计算机分析,Fd 段基因的全长为639bp ,编码213 个氨基酸,属于人Ig G2 亚类。 The total cell RNA extracted from peripheral lymphocytes of HFRS patient was transcribed reversely into cDNA. The Fd fragments and light chain genes of human antibodies were amplified from cDNA using semi nested polymerase chain reaction. Fd fragments genes were cloned into vector pcomb3 and pGEM7zf. One of positive clones selected randomly was sequenced.The results indicated that the Fd fragment gene consisted of 639bp, encoded 213 amino acid residues,and belonged to human IgG2.
